SAVE OUR CHILDREN IMPROVE THE QUALITY OF LIFE FOR DISADVANTAGED CHILDREN BY PROVIDING ASSISTANCE, SUPPORT, RELIEF PROGRAMS, JOB TRAINING, AND TEACHING.
SAVE OUR CHILDREN has received 54 grants from 53 known foundation funders. Revenue decreased from $426,993 in 2023 to $199,745 in 2024. Most recent reported revenue: $199,745.
